The Border Security Force (BSF), a symbol of steadfast patriotism, received laudatory recognition from Union Home Minister Amit Shah on its raising day. The BSF, tasked with guarding India's borders with Pakistan and Bangladesh, was commended for its unwavering dedication and valor.
In a message shared on 'X', Shah extended his greetings to the BSF personnel and their families, acknowledging the force's vital role in upholding national honor. He highlighted the BSF's role in maintaining the country's security and praised the indomitable spirit of its members.
With 193 battalions and over 2.76 lakh personnel, the BSF vigilantly monitors the borders, ensuring national security. Shah paid tribute to the brave hearts who made the ultimate sacrifice in the line of duty, noting that their legacy will guide future generations.
